#e0528f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e0528f is composed of 87.8% red, 32.2%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.4%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 334.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 60%. #e0528f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#c1001f.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e0528f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e0528f has RGB values of R:224, G:82,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.36,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14701199.

Hex triplet e0528f #e0528f
RGB Decimal 224, 82, 143 rgb(224,82,143)
RGB Percent 87.8, 32.2, 56.1 rgb(87.8%,32.2%,56.1%)
CMYK 0, 63, 36, 12
HSL 334.2°, 69.6, 60 hsl(334.2,69.6%,60%)
HSV (or HSB) 334.2°, 63.4, 87.8
Web Safe cc6699 #cc6699
CIE-LAB 55.956, 60.488, -3.954
XYZ 38.716, 23.868, 28.553
xyY 0.425, 0.262, 23.868
CIE-LCH 55.956, 60.617, 356.26
CIE-LUV 55.956, 89.611, -16.754
Hunter-Lab 48.855, 55.959, -0.453
Binary 11100000, 01010010, 10001111

Shades and Tints of #e0528f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0205 is the darkest color, while #fef8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e0528f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999999 is the less saturated color, while #f83a8c is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e0528f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#838383 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#967985 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#828aaf Protanopia 1% of men
  • #99888a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#de646a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a476a3 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b3748c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#de5d77 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
